How many students are in the York University engineering program?
The program is pretty hard, but engineering is hard at whatever school you choose. To put things into some perspective, about 120 new students were enrolled in York’s engineering program in 2012. Of those students about 50 made it to second year.
What kind of programs does York University have?
With 200+ programs to choose from, our strength has always been truly exceptional programs. York U is home to Canada’s largest liberal arts program, the only Space Engineering program in the country, a new Global Health program and a unique cross-discipline Digital Media program.
